OCB 2010 - Marine Biology-AA 3 class hours 3 Credit(s) Prerequisite(s): BSC 1010 or one year of high school biology Co-requisite(s): OCB 2010L This course is an introduction to the biology of the sea with an emphasis on the structural, physiological and behavioral adaptations of marine life. Discussions will center on organisms from the smallest microbes to the largest marine vertebrates and the roles they play in marine ecosystems. Special attention will be paid to the delicate communities of Southwest Florida, including mangrove forests and coral reefs.
